这是一个备受关注的话题。如果您是一位MySQL管理员或开发人员,您可能会遇到这个问题。在本文中,我们将提供一些有价值的信息,帮助您破解MySQL表中的密码。
首先,让我们了解一下MySQL的密码安全性。MySQL使用哈希算法来存储密码。哈希算法将密码转换成一段长度固定的字符串,称为哈希值。这个哈希值存储在MySQL表中,而不是原始密码。这样做可以保护密码的安全性,即使黑客入侵数据库,也无法获得原始密码。
然而,有时候您需要破解MySQL表中的密码。比如,您可能需要访问一个被遗忘的账户,或者您可能需要证明一个安全漏洞。下面是一些破解MySQL表中密码的方法:
1. 使用暴力破解法。这是一种简单而又有效的方法,但需要耗费大量时间和计算资源。暴力破解法尝试使用所有可能的密码组合,直到找到正确的密码。这个过程可能需要数小时、数天,甚至数周。
2. 使用字典攻击法。这种方法利用常见密码和单词列表,尝试每个密码,直到找到正确的密码。这种方法比暴力破解法快得多,但需要一个好的密码字典。
3. 使用社会工程学攻击法。这种方法利用人类行为心理学,尝试猜测密码。这种方法可能需要一些社交工程技巧,例如通过社交媒体或其他途径获取有关目标的信息。
4. 使用SQL注入攻击法。这种方法利用应用程序的漏洞,获取MySQL表中的密码。这种方法需要一些黑客技能,同时也可能是非法的。
在破解MySQL表中的密码时,需要注意以下几点:
1. 尊重隐私。不要试图破解没有授权的账户。
2. 遵守法律。破解MySQL表中的密码可能是非法的,需要遵守当地的法律法规。
3. 使用安全的方法。破解MySQL表中的密码可能会暴露数据库中的其他信息。因此,需要使用安全的方法,以免影响数据库的安全性。
总之,破解MySQL表中的密码是一个复杂而又敏感的问题。如果您需要破解密码,请使用合适的方法,同时遵守相关法律法规。同时,如果您是MySQL管理员或开发人员,应该采取措施保护数据库的安全性,以避免密码被破解。